Handover: N+1 fix, Grevane GraphQL layer. Batched the resolver loads with a dataloader per request; plugin authors must not call the entity fetcher inside field resolvers anymore. Use the batch hook instead. Old path still works but logs a deprecation warning and will be removed next minor. Perf gain is roughly 8x on nested queries. Batching behavior is controlled by the settings below.

config for kafof-bawef:
holath:
  log_level: debug
  metrics_host: metrics.holath.qorvelsys.internal
  pin: 2191
  pool_size: 32

**Q: How do I deduplicate customer records in Mergewell?**

A: Mergewell flags suspected duplicates nightly using fuzzy matching on name, postal fields, and order history. Review each candidate pair in the Reconcile queue before confirming a merge, since merges cannot be undone without a full restore. If you must roll back a bad merge, open the archived-snapshot tool and request the sealed backup set. To decrypt that backup during a rollback, enter the recovery passphrase shown below.

recovery phrase for bawef-haduf: wenax-druox-julmir

## Onboarding — Markdown Pipeline (Inkmere)

Inkmere docs render through a three-stage pipeline: parse, sanitize, emit. Releases rebuild all templates; never hot-patch emitted HTML. Broken renders usually mean a sanitizer rule change — check the rules diff first. The render cluster only accepts builds from the release channel, and every build artifact must be signed before upload. Sign artifacts with the deploy key below.

release key, hafop-tajef: bky13_s2vaFVNJTHfBL